Transaction 2050300168a9ebeb94c109f25a9f4bc15c11f7ded63d90e3a9cff6500d9c711a
1 Input
1 Output
-
2050300168a9ebeb94c109f25a9f4bc15c11f7ded63d90e3a9cff6500d9c711a:0
- value
- 1839594
- script pubkey
- OP_0 OP_PUSHBYTES_20 998e485f84868e1d410a711d672ae45641b43a00
- address
- bc1qnx8yshuys68p6sg2wywkw2hy2eqmgwsqkf8h9f